According to TechSci Research report, “Interaction
Sensor Market – Global Industry Size, Share, Trends, Competition Forecast
& Opportunities, 2028”, the Global Interaction Sensor Market is
experiencing a surge in demand in the forecast period. One of the primary
drivers propelling the global Interaction Sensor market is the continuous and
rapid advancement in sensor technology. Interaction sensors serve as the bridge
between humans and technology, enabling devices to understand and respond to
various forms of human input. These sensors have witnessed remarkable progress
in recent years, transforming the way we interact with technology. The
development of capacitive touchscreens, 3D gesture recognition, and
voice-controlled interfaces are examples of technological breakthroughs in
interaction sensors. These innovations have significantly improved the
sensitivity, accuracy, and efficiency of human-device interactions. As a
result, devices have become more user-friendly and responsive, enhancing user
experiences across various sectors, including consumer electronics, automotive,
and healthcare. Moreover, emerging technologies like LiDAR and radar sensors
are expanding the applications of interaction sensors in fields such as
autonomous vehicles and augmented reality (AR) devices. The continuous
improvement in sensor technology not only fuels innovation but also opens new
avenues for interaction sensor applications, making it a pivotal driver in the
growth of the global Interaction Sensor market.
The escalating demand for Internet of Things (IoT) and
smart devices serves as another major driver for the global Interaction Sensor
market. IoT has ushered in an era where everyday objects are connected to the
internet, creating an ecosystem of devices that interact with each other and
with humans. Interaction sensors play a fundamental role in facilitating
communication and control within this ecosystem. Smartphones, smart home
devices, wearable technology, and industrial automation systems all rely on interaction
sensors to enable seamless user interactions. These sensors allow users to
control and monitor their devices, providing a convenient and connected
experience. The expansion of IoT in industries like healthcare, transportation,
and agriculture has further amplified the demand for interaction sensors. In
healthcare, for example, wearable devices equipped with sensors monitor vital
signs and provide data to both patients and medical professionals. In
agriculture, IoT sensors are used to monitor soil conditions and weather,
optimizing crop production.
The global Interaction Sensor market benefits from
this growing demand for IoT and smart devices. As more industries adopt IoT and
smart technologies, the demand for interaction sensors is expected to continue
to rise, making it a key driver in the market's expansion.

The Global Interaction Sensor Market is segmented into
technology, industry verticals and region. Based on technology, The Camera Based segment held the
largest Market share in 2022. Camera-based interaction sensors offer a wide
range of applications, making them highly versatile. They can capture 2D and 3D
data, recognize gestures, track facial expressions, and identify objects. This
versatility allows them to be used in diverse sectors, from gaming and
automotive to healthcare and security. Camera-based systems provide a natural
and intuitive way for users to interact with devices and applications. Gesture
recognition, in particular, allows users to control devices with simple hand
movements, making the user experience more user-friendly and immersive.
Camera-based sensors play a vital role in AR and VR applications, where they
track the user's movements and surroundings. These technologies are becoming
increasingly popular in gaming, training, and simulation, driving the demand
for camera-based interaction sensors. Facial recognition, a subset of
camera-based technology, is widely used for security and authentication
purposes. It offers a high level of security and convenience for unlocking
devices, making digital payments, and accessing secure locations. The consumer
electronics sector, including smartphones and smart TVs, has seen significant
adoption of camera-based interaction sensors. Devices with front and rear
cameras use them for tasks like facial recognition, photography, and augmented
reality applications. Camera-based sensors are used in healthcare for tasks
such as telemedicine, remote patient monitoring, and medical imaging. They
enable healthcare professionals to examine patients remotely and capture
detailed images for diagnostic purposes. In smart homes, cameras are often used
for security, monitoring, and automation. These applications include
surveillance cameras, video doorbells, and AI-powered home automation systems
that recognize users and adapt to their preferences. In the automotive sector,
camera-based technology is crucial for advanced driver assistance systems
(ADAS), which include features like lane-keeping assistance and adaptive cruise
control. These systems rely on cameras to monitor the vehicle's surroundings
and assist with safe driving.
Based on industry verticals, The Consumer Electronics
segment held the largest Market share in 2022. Consumer electronics represent a
vast and ever-expanding market with a diverse range of devices, including
smartphones, tablets, smart TVs, gaming consoles, wearables, and smart home
appliances. The sheer size of the consumer electronics market creates
significant demand for interaction sensors. Interaction sensors, such as
touchscreens, accelerometers, and voice recognition systems, are integrated
into nearly all consumer electronic devices. This integration has become a
standard feature, enabling intuitive and user-friendly interactions with
technology. Touchscreens, for example, have become the primary interface for
smartphones and tablets. Consumer electronics are subject to rapid
technological advancements and product refresh cycles. As new features and
capabilities are introduced, manufacturers often rely on advanced interaction
sensors to differentiate their products and attract consumers. This continual
innovation drives the demand for the latest sensor technologies. User
experience is a critical factor in the consumer electronics market. Interaction
sensors enable more natural and seamless interactions, enhancing user
satisfaction. Features like gesture recognition, voice control, and responsive
touchscreens have become key selling points for devices, contributing to their
dominance. The consumer electronics market is highly competitive, with numerous
manufacturers vying for market share. To stay competitive, companies invest
heavily in research and development to create innovative interaction sensor
technologies. This competitive landscape fosters innovation and drives the
adoption of advanced sensors. The proliferation
of smart home devices, such as smart thermostats, voice-activated assistants,
and connected appliances, relies on interaction sensors for user control and
automation. The increasing popularity of smart homes has further boosted the
demand for interaction sensors in the consumer electronics sector. Gaming
consoles, augmented reality (AR), and virtual reality (VR) devices heavily rely
on interaction sensors. These technologies have gained traction in the consumer
electronics market, creating a substantial need for advanced sensors that can
provide immersive and interactive experiences.
